Tip 1: Brush Your Teeth Regularly
Brushing your teeth at the very least twice a day is critical for eliminating plaque and avoiding dental cavity. Utilize a soft-bristled toothbrush and fluoride toothpaste to gently clean your teeth and periodontals. Make sure to clean all surface areas of your teeth, consisting of the front, back, and eating surfaces.
Tip 2: Floss Daily
Flossing plays an essential role in maintaining ideal oral hygiene by removing plaque and food bits from in between your teeth. It assists reach areas that a toothbrush can not access, minimizing the danger of tooth decay and gum tissue condition. Include flossing right into your everyday oral treatment routine for best results.
Tip 3: Restriction Sugary Foods and Drinks
Consuming too much quantities of sweet foods and beverages can increase the risk of dental cavity. The microorganisms in our mouth feed upon sugar, creating acids that assault the enamel. Limitation your intake of sugary treats, sodas, and sweets to shield your teeth from decay.
Tip 4: Opt for Healthy Snacks
Instead of reaching for sweet treats, opt for healthier choices such as fruits, veggies, or nuts. These foods not only provide vital nutrients yet additionally aid boost saliva production, which assists in neutralizing acids in the mouth.
Tip 5: Consume A Lot Of Water
Water is crucial for maintaining ideal oral health and wellness. It helps get rid of food particles and germs from your mouth, lowering the danger of dental cavity. Consuming fluoridated water can likewise give extra security against cavities.
Tip 6: Usage Fluoride Products
Fluoride is an all-natural mineral that reinforces the enamel and protects against dental caries. Use fluoride toothpaste and mouth wash as component of your daily dental treatment routine. You can additionally ask your dentist concerning fluoride treatments for added protection.

Q: Exactly how usually ought to I go to the dentist? A: It is recommended to check out the dentist at the very least twice a year for normal examinations and cleansings. Nevertheless, individuals with particular oral conditions may call for more regular visits.
Q: Can dental cavity be reversed? A: Dental caries in its early stages can be reversed via proper oral hygiene and professional intervention. Nevertheless, progressed stages of degeneration might require corrective treatments such as dental fillings or crowns.
Q: Is it regular for my gum tissues to bleed when I brush my teeth? A: No, bleeding gum tissues are not regular and might suggest gum disease or improper brushing technique. Speak with your dentist if you experience hemorrhaging gum tissues to identify the underlying cause and get ideal treatment.
Q: Are natural remedies reliable in stopping tooth decay? A: While some all-natural treatments may have anti-bacterial properties, they can not replace routine cleaning, flossing, and expert dental care. It is best to make use of natural solutions as complements to correct oral health practices.
Q: Can bad oral health impact overall health? A: Yes, inadequate dental wellness has actually been connected to different systemic problems such as heart problem, diabetic issues, respiratory infections, and pregnancy issues. Preserving optimum dental health and wellness is vital for total health.
Q: What need to I do if I have a dental emergency? A: In situation of a dental emergency situation such as extreme toothache, knocked-out tooth, or injury to the mouth, call your dentist immediately for support and prompt treatment.
